Metaverse Thinktank Investment Company Limited (MTI) was established in 2020 as a subsidiary of Senlong Technology Limited. The firm is dedicated to the development of the metaverse and innovative industries, positioning itself as a leader in this emerging sector. Operating primarily as a family office, MTI collaborates with quantitative strategy teams and algorithmic trading teams to cover both traditional finance and digital assets.
MTI operates under two main platforms: Qiyuan Capital and Biheng. Qiyuan Capital focuses on digital asset management and investments in technology startups and blockchain projects. Biheng, on the other hand, offers online learning services related to cryptocurrency and the financial ecosystem of the metaverse. This dual approach allows MTI to not only invest in promising ventures but also educate individuals about the financial opportunities within the metaverse.
Meta Thinktank Investment (MTI) concentrates its investments in sectors related to the metaverse, particularly digital asset management and blockchain technology. The firm emphasizes the importance of cryptocurrency education, aiming to enhance understanding of financial opportunities within the metaverse ecosystem. MTI seeks to invest in innovative technology startups that align with its vision of a digitally interconnected future.
Investment stages typically include early to growth stages, with check sizes varying based on the specific opportunity and the potential for impact within the metaverse. Geographic focus is primarily on Asia, where MTI aims to leverage its strategic partnerships to identify and support promising ventures. The firm values founders who demonstrate a strong understanding of their market and possess a clear vision for their projects.
